Seimas turns to Constitutional Court over dual citizenship

The Lithuanian parliament on Tuesday asked the Constitutional Court to look at whether it is necessary to amend the Constitution to allow dual citizenship for people who left for EU or NATO member states after Lithuania regained independence in 1990. […]

Transparency International urges President to veto lobbyism law

Transparency International Lithuania on Tuesday urged President Dalia Grybauskaitė to veto the law on lobbyist activities adopted by the country’s parliament earlier in the day. […]

State property overhaul would save Lithuania EUR 20 mln per year – PM

An overhaul of the management of state-owned real estate would allow Lithuania to save 20 million euros in the first year and that amount would increase in subsequent years, Prime Minister Saulius Skvernelis said on Monday. […]

PM calls for parliamentary probe into allegations involving MP Skardzius

Prime Minister Saulius Skvernelis calls for a parliamentary probe into allegations that Arturas Skardzius, a member of the Seimas’ Energy Commission, represents the interests of wind energy companies he leases land to, and for a broader analysis of business groups’ influence on lawmakers. […]
